JABAR - A motorcyclist who was lost in a flood in Cihaurbeuti, Ciamis, was found lifeless in Tasikmalaya Regency, West Java (West Java). The location of the discovery is tens of kilometers from the initial location missing.

Head of the Emergency and Logistics Division of the Ciamis Regency Regional Disaster Management Agency (BPBD), Memet Hikmat, said the victim was on behalf of Endang Setiawan.

"The address is at Sukahening Village, Tasikmalaya Regency, the victim was swept away by the current of the Cibuyut River, Cihaurbeuti District on Friday (October 7)," Memet said in a written broadcast, quoted from Antara, Thursday, October 13.

He said the victim was a motorcycle rider carried away by the overflowing flood of the Cibuyut River in Cihaurbeuti District. Joint officers searched for victims by walking along the river.

Joint officers operating to search, said Memet, received information on the discovery of the body by an angler in Leuwi Jurig, Cineam District, Tasikmalaya Regency, Wednesday, October 12 afternoon.

"After receiving this information, the search team from the Ciamis BPBD headed to the location and immediately informed the news to the Tasikmalaya BPBD and the Tasikmalaya Police, because the location of the body was in Cineam District, Tasikmalaya Regency," he said.

He conveyed that joint officers from the Ciamis Regency Government and the Police in Tasikmalaya Regency identified the bodies found on the riverbank.

Furthermore, the victim was evacuated to Dr. Soekarjo Tasikmalaya Hospital for further examination, finally the victim was identified and confirmed by the family that the body was based on the characteristics of a victim who was lost in the river current in Cihaurbeuti.

He said that after it was confirmed that the victim's body was dragged by the current, then the search operation for the victim was stopped, then handed over the victim's body to his family for burial.

"The Tasikmalaya Police handed over the body to the family to be buried at the funeral home," he said.
